How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Deer Park?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
Deer Park Studio Apartments | $1,437 | $1,224 | $2,035 |
| Deer Park 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,668 | $1,365 | $2,450 |
| Deer Park 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,978 | $1,549 | $2,870 |
| Deer Park 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,654 | $2,080 | $4,050 |
| Deer Park 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,806 | $2,588 | $2,923 |
